Programs
TrevorClassic (U.S)
Our core program, Crisis Intervention, meets young people where they are and uplifts support to meet their needs. LGBTQ+ young people demonstrate their courage every day, accessing our crisis services at critical moments in their lives. Our trained crisis counselors support young people by affirming their experiences, de-escalating their level of suicide risk, and helping them build a plan for continued safety. Our Crisis Intervention services are also made directly available to LGBTQ+ young people in Central Mexico and Latin America. Through nonpartisan efforts at the federal, state, and local levels, Trevor advocates for the rights and futures of LGBTQ+ young people through legislation, litigation, and coalition-building.
